Kernel Fusion Techniques 2023 Improved Transformer Throughput in LLaMA Deployments

Combining multiple GPU operations into single kernels increased language model throughput without changing the model itself.

Top Ad Slot
🤯 Did You Know (click to read)

GPU kernel fusion reduces overhead by minimizing global memory reads and writes between sequential operations.

Kernel fusion merges consecutive GPU operations to reduce memory transfers and execution overhead. In 2023, transformer optimization efforts applied fusion strategies to attention and feed-forward layers. This improved inference speed for models like LLaMA. Reduced memory traffic minimized latency under heavy workloads. Performance gains occurred without altering learned parameters. Software optimization complemented hardware scaling. Production deployments prioritized throughput consistency. Kernel fusion exemplified engineering refinement beyond algorithmic novelty. Efficiency multiplied impact.

Mid-Content Ad Slot
💥 Impact (click to read)

Institutionally, throughput gains lowered per-request inference costs. Cloud providers integrated fused kernels into runtime libraries. Enterprises achieved higher request capacity without proportional hardware expansion. Performance engineering became a competitive differentiator. Hardware-software co-design deepened collaboration between vendors and developers. Optimization reduced infrastructure strain. Efficiency translated into margin.

For developers, faster inference improved user experience in interactive applications. Reduced latency increased perceived intelligence. Users rarely notice kernel fusion, yet they experience its effect in response speed. LLaMA’s conversational flow depended on invisible GPU orchestration. Intelligence required streamlined execution.

Source

NVIDIA CUDA Programming Guide

LinkedIn Reddit

⚡ Ready for another mind-blower?

‹ Previous Next ›

💬 Comments